Brick cleaning services involve the thorough removal of dirt, grime, moss, algae, and stains that accumulate on brick surfaces over time. This process typically uses specialized cleaning methods designed to restore the appearance of brickwork without damaging the material. Contractors may employ techniques such as high-pressure washing or gentle chemical treatments to effectively clean the surface, ensuring that the brick retains its structural integrity while looking refreshed and well-maintained.
These services help address common problems like unsightly stains, mold growth, and the buildup of moss or algae, which can cause bricks to appear dull or discolored. Over time, these issues can also lead to deterioration of the brick surface if left untreated. Brick cleaning can improve curb appeal, prevent potential damage, and prepare surfaces for further maintenance or sealing. The overview below groups typical Brick Cleaning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or brick cleaning projects usually range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le band, covering cleaning of small to medium-sized areas. Fewer projects tend to push into the higher end of this range.
Standard Residential Cleaning - for cleaning larger sections of residential brickwork, costs generally range from $600 to $1,500. This is a common price band for most homeowner projects involving multiple walls or facades.
Commercial or Large-Scale Projects - larger, more complex brick cleaning jobs for commercial properties can range from $1,500 to $5,000 or more. These projects often involve extensive surfaces or intricate brickwork, which can increase the cost.
Full Replacement or Specialty Work - in cases where brick surfaces require full replacement or specialized cleaning techniques, costs can exceed $5,000. Such projects are less common but are necessary for significant damage or historic preservation efforts.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is brick cleaning? Brick cleaning involves removing dirt, stains, moss, and other buildup from brick surfaces to restore their appearance and improve durability.
What methods do local contractors use for brick cleaning? They typically use pressure washing, chemical cleaning solutions, or a combination of both to effectively clean brick surfaces.
Is brick cleaning suitable for all types of brick surfaces? Most brick surfaces can be cleaned safely, but it's advisable to consult with local service providers to determine the best approach for specific materials.
How often should brick surfaces be cleaned? The frequency depends on environmental conditions and exposure, but regular inspections can help determine when cleaning is needed.
What are the benefits of professional brick cleaning? Professional cleaning can enhance the appearance, prevent damage caused by moss or stains, and extend the lifespan of brick surfaces.
